Pedro Guerra-Zúñiga has a fighting spirit — a spirit that especially likes to laugh.
Growing up, Pedro expected to get cancer, at some point, probably in his 60s. Fate has a funny disposition, though, so when he was diagnosed with non-Hodgkin lymphoma, Pedro decided to respond on his terms: with humor and a goal of making Team Canada.
After all, you never know what can happen.
